Guitar Model Names
While there are many makes and models for guitars, the most popular is the Dreadnought. These instruments were larger than the typical guitar when they were first manufactured in 1916. Their larger than normal size led them to be named after the British battleship HMS Dreadnought. The HMS Dreadnought was the first of the modern battleships and was the first to be powered by a steam turbine.
Beckwith Strings' dreadnought guitars are named after various classes of WWI and WWII battleships (or dreadnoughts) as a tribute to these by-gone ships and their sailors. The smaller, orchestra models are named after WWII cruisers. Travel and parlor guitars are named after Destroyers - "The Greyhounds of the Navy". The jumbo guitars are named after aircraft carriers – the ships that changed the shape of naval power and mothballed the battleship.
